Pretty sure you can put a dual 120mm radiator in the top of the H440.

6042_27_nzxt_h440_mid_tower_chassis_review_first_case_to_score_top_marks.jpg


20-Inside.jpg


Razer-H440-Top-Panel-No-Cover.jpg


That's what you're dealing with in the H440.

If you need remove components a lot, notably the PSU, then the H440 may not be the case for you and something without with PSU shroud like a Phantom might be better. The PSU shroud is lovely because it hides all of those ugly cables and makes the machine look so clean but I can imagine it being a bit of a pain if you need to quickly remove a power supply.
